Climate & Weather
Sainte-Eulalie has a cool climate with an average annual temperature of 41°F. Winters average 10°F in January while summers reach 67°F in July. With 263 sunny days per year, residents enjoy well above the national average of sunshine. Annual precipitation totals 40.0 inches, including 14.3 inches of snow.

What is the population of Sainte-Eulalie?
Sainte-Eulalie has a population of 984 residents and is located in Quebec. The population density is 30 people per square mile, spread across 33.3 square miles. The median age of residents is 39.2 years. The population is 46.7% female and 52.8% male.
